## Usage

Following are some ways through which you can access the paypal provider:

```php
// Import the class namespaces first, before using it directly
use Srmklive\PayPal\Services\PayPal as PayPalClient;

$provider = new PayPalClient;

// Through facade. No need to import namespaces
$provider = \PayPal::setProvider();
```


## Configuration File

The configuration file **paypal.php** is located in the **config** folder. Following are its contents when published:

```php
return [
'mode' => env('PAYPAL_MODE', 'sandbox'), // Can only be 'sandbox' Or 'live'. If empty or invalid, 'live' will be used.
'sandbox' => [
'client_id' => env('PAYPAL_SANDBOX_CLIENT_ID', ''),
'client_secret' => env('PAYPAL_SANDBOX_CLIENT_SECRET', ''),
'app_id' => 'APP-80W284485P519543T',
],
'live' => [
'client_id' => env('PAYPAL_LIVE_CLIENT_ID', ''),
'client_secret' => env('PAYPAL_LIVE_CLIENT_SECRET', ''),
'app_id' => env('PAYPAL_LIVE_APP_ID', ''),
],

'payment_action' => env('PAYPAL_PAYMENT_ACTION', 'Sale'), // Can only be 'Sale', 'Authorization' or 'Order'
'currency' => env('PAYPAL_CURRENCY', 'USD'),
'notify_url' => env('PAYPAL_NOTIFY_URL', ''), // Change this accordingly for your application.
'locale' => env('PAYPAL_LOCALE', 'en_US'), // force gateway language i.e. it_IT, es_ES, en_US ... (for express checkout only)
'validate_ssl' => env('PAYPAL_VALIDATE_SSL', true), // Validate SSL when creating api client.
];
```

## Override PayPal API Configuration

You can override PayPal API configuration by calling `setApiCredentials` method:

```php
$config = [
'mode' => 'live',
'live' => [
'client_id' => 'PAYPAL_LIVE_CLIENT_ID',
'client_secret' => 'PAYPAL_LIVE_CLIENT_SECRET',
'app_id' => 'PAYPAL_LIVE_APP_ID',
],

'payment_action' => 'Sale',
'currency' => 'USD',
'notify_url' => 'https://your-site.com/paypal/notify',
'locale' => 'en_US',
'validate_ssl' => true,
];
$provider->setApiCredentials($config);
```


## Get Access Token

After setting the PayPal API configuration by calling `setApiCredentials` method. You need to get access token before performing any API calls

```php
$provider->getAccessToken();
```


## Set Currency

By default, the currency used is `USD`. If you wish to change it, you may call `setCurrency` method to set a different currency before calling any respective API methods:

```php
$provider->setCurrency('EUR');
```


## Helper Methods

> Please note that in the examples below, the call to `addPlanTrialPricing` is optional and it can be omitted when you are creating subscriptions without trial period.

> `setReturnAndCancelUrl()` is optional. If you set urls you have to use real domains. e.g. localhost, project.test does not work.

### Create Recurring Daily Subscription

```php
$response = $provider->addProduct('Demo Product', 'Demo Product', 'SERVICE', 'SOFTWARE')
->addPlanTrialPricing('DAY', 7)
->addDailyPlan('Demo Plan', 'Demo Plan', 1.50)
->setReturnAndCancelUrl('https://example.com/paypal-success', 'https://example.com/paypal-cancel')
->setupSubscription('John Doe', '[email protected]', '2021-12-10');
```

### Create Recurring Weekly Subscription

```php
$response = $provider->addProduct('Demo Product', 'Demo Product', 'SERVICE', 'SOFTWARE')
->addPlanTrialPricing('DAY', 7)
->addWeeklyPlan('Demo Plan', 'Demo Plan', 30)
->setReturnAndCancelUrl('https://example.com/paypal-success', 'https://example.com/paypal-cancel')
->setupSubscription('John Doe', '[email protected]', '2021-12-10');
```

### Create Recurring Monthly Subscription

```php
$response = $provider->addProduct('Demo Product', 'Demo Product', 'SERVICE', 'SOFTWARE')
->addPlanTrialPricing('DAY', 7)
->addMonthlyPlan('Demo Plan', 'Demo Plan', 100)
->setReturnAndCancelUrl('https://example.com/paypal-success', 'https://example.com/paypal-cancel')
->setupSubscription('John Doe', '[email protected]', '2021-12-10');
```

### Create Recurring Annual Subscription

```php
$response = $provider->addProduct('Demo Product', 'Demo Product', 'SERVICE', 'SOFTWARE')
->addPlanTrialPricing('DAY', 7)
->addAnnualPlan('Demo Plan', 'Demo Plan', 600)
->setReturnAndCancelUrl('https://example.com/paypal-success', 'https://example.com/paypal-cancel')
->setupSubscription('John Doe', '[email protected]', '2021-12-10');
```

### Create Recurring Subscription with Custom Intervals

```php
$response = $provider->addProduct('Demo Product', 'Demo Product', 'SERVICE', 'SOFTWARE')
->addCustomPlan('Demo Plan', 'Demo Plan', 150, 'MONTH', 3)
->setReturnAndCancelUrl('https://example.com/paypal-success', 'https://example.com/paypal-cancel')
->setupSubscription('John Doe', '[email protected]', '2021-12-10');
```

### Create Subscription by Existing Product & Billing Plan

```php
$response = $this->client->addProductById('PROD-XYAB12ABSB7868434')
->addBillingPlanById('P-5ML4271244454362WXNWU5NQ')
->setReturnAndCancelUrl('https://example.com/paypal-success', 'https://example.com/paypal-cancel')
->setupSubscription('John Doe', '[email protected]', $start_date);
```


## Support

This version supports Laravel 6 or greater.
